New and Promising Botanical Ingredient

07 Jun 2015 | Indena

Boswellic acids have long been considered the main bioactive components of Boswellia serrata, and many studies in vitro and in animals have confirmed their bioactivities. In particular, recent mechanistic studies have validated the capacity of the β-boswellic acids group to modulate inflammatory response, but preliminary pharmacokinetic studies in animals and humans have highlighted their poor oral absorption. To overcome this problem, Indena has formulated a purified mixture of boswellic acids from Boswellia serrata with lecithin, taking advantage of its proprietary Phytosome technology platform to optimize their absorption.
